Uschi Glas, a name that resonates with the golden era of German cinema, is a celebrated actress whose career spans over five decades. Born on March 2, 1944, in Landau an der Isar, Bavaria, she became a household name in the 1960s and 1970s. Her breakthrough came with the 1965 film "Sperrbezirk," and she quickly became one of the most beloved figures in the German film industry. Glas's charm and talent have made her a staple in both film and television, and her work continues to influence the entertainment landscape in Germany and beyond.
